Question 1175037: A population grows according to an exponential growth model, with Po =20 and P1 = 24
Pn=______xPn-1
Explicit formula for Pn
Pn=______

HINT


It is geometric progression with the common ratio of  P1%2FP0 = 24%2F20 = 6%2F5.


    P%5Bn%5D = %286%2F5%29%2AP%5Bn-1%5D.


Explicit formula


    P%5Bn%5D = 20%2A%286%2F5%29%5En, n = 0, 1, 2, 3, . . . 


Notice that in this progression, indexation is not traditional: the first index value is 0 (not 1, as it is traditionally).
